The Professional Resource List assignment requires the creation of a structured document that effectively catalogs valuable online resources pertinent to healthcare management, billing, and policy information. This task involves organizing information systematically within three columns: the title of each resource, its corresponding URL, and a descriptive summary highlighting the contents and significance of each website. The purpose of this exercise is to develop a comprehensive, accessible directory that can serve as a reliable reference for healthcare professionals, students, or administrators seeking current and authoritative information relevant to their field.

To begin, the organizer must identify credible and current online sources that provide relevant data, guidelines, or policy updates. These sources might include government websites such as the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services, professional associations, and reputable healthcare information portals. Each identified resource should be thoroughly examined to ascertain the specific content offered and its practical application within healthcare management practices.

For example, a relevant entry could be formatted in the following manner:

- Title: Centers for Medicare and Medicaid

- Link: https://www.cms.gov/

- Description: The official government website providing comprehensive information on billing, policy updates, procedural guidelines, and management tools for Medicare and Medicaid programs. This resource is vital for healthcare administrators and billing professionals to ensure compliance with current regulations and to facilitate efficient patient coverage processes.
